Abstract :
In this work we present a new on-line water pollution monitoring system. The system includes a smart array of ion-selective field effect transistors (ISFETs) as a front-end and also at post-processing stages in order to transmit the stored measures of ion concentrations. The intelligence in the smart sensors is provided by a blind source separation (BSS) algorithm which continuously learns from measures of how to detect the ion concentrations available in the mixed signal observed in the array´s output. The computational simplicity of the BSS algorithm and its capability of continuous learning from the environment, allow the design of a low-power, cheap and small system that monitors water in real-time, and is a contrast to the classical off-line approach based on a water analysis of the extracted measures in the laboratory. The work is in progress, as part of the SEWING project (IST-2000-28084).
